So, with a bit of forethought and sensible naming conventions, I can quickly build up quite a network of cards. You can also crosslink as described above in nvAlt using the [[ and typing the first letters of the card you wish to crosslink to). Folks just getting started – start with nvAlt. Then, highlight the other options and hit the – button. Hit the + button under each one in turn, adding ‘md’. In ‘preferences, notes, storage’ there are two lists of file types. It’s a bit like Notational Velocity in that regard (and of course, you could use Notational Velocity if you wanted, though – I’d have to check – I don’t think you can save your notes as separate. If there is no file when I hit ] as the file name. When I type ] and I can ctrl click on that link to jump to the other file. In essence, Dan’s system is just a simple plugin for Sublime Text that designates a particular folder a ‘wiki’. In an earlier post I got the one-card-per-note ‘zettlekasten’ system that Dan Sheffler uses working on my machine (by the way, you will learn a *lot* if you spend some time reading Dan’s thoughts on the art of note taking). So what is this solution? Zettlekasten + Pykwiki. Mark Madsen’s explanation of how his open notebook works – and the logic he organizes it by – is similarly an inspiration: Īnd Ben Marwick’s work is pathbreaking (especially within archaeology): But first:Ĭaleb McDaniel’s eloquent argument for why one would want to do it is here: Tonight, I think I’ve hit a combination of tools that are sufficiently powerful and straightforward enough that I can integrate them into my undergraduate teaching. Never use atom-live-server as a private server with public network access.I’ve been looking for an open notebook solution for some time. Note: When hosting a web server on Windows, the Windows Defender Firewall may request you to confirm which sorts of networks to allow access to. This allows you to view changes to the code as they happen and speeds up the design and development process. It will always display the most recent version of the files. This implies that when working with HTML, CSS, and JavaScript, the webpage will refresh as soon as the file is saved. To put it another way, this is a private, local version of a web server.Ītom-live-server reloads the content when files are saved in Atom. When atom-live-server is started, it launches a web server on port 3000 on the localhost. Stop: (Once launched, it may be terminated by going to Packages –> atom-live-server –> Stop.) Start:Click Packages –> atom-live-server –> Start server to launch the web-server for the currently open project (folder). (This process can take seconds to up to few minutes depending on bandwidth and other factors.) Using a package called live server in atom.Ītom now includes a local web server thanks to the atom-live-server package. In the “Search packages” text area or input field, type "atom-live-server" to find the package.Ĭlick "Install" to download and install the atom-live-server package. Go to Packages –> Settings View –> Install Packages/Theme screen allows for installing new ones. Use it for tinkering with your HTML/JavaScript/CSS files, but not for releasing the finished product. This is a small development server with the ability to reload in real time. Live Server that makes your existing server live - this is a Web Extension that helps you to live reload feature for dynamic content (PHP, Node.js, ASPNET - Whatever, it doesn't matter). The GitHub package is pre-installed with Atom, so you're good to go! Installing Atom The GitHub package allows you to interact with Git and GitHub directly from Atom.Ĭreate new branches, stage and commit them, push and pull them, handle merge conflicts, see pull requests, and more - all from your editor. GitHub for AtomĪ text editor is at the heart of a developer's toolkit, yet it hardly works alone. Atom is a desktop program that was created using HTML, JavaScript, CSS, and Node.js. The editor is totally hackable, which means you can set it to function exactly how you want it to - either through plugins or by modifying the code yourself. A hackable text editor for the 21st Century There are a lot of individuals on Github who are following the Atom repository, staring the repository, and actually using the editor. Because Github is now owned by Microsoft, Atom is technically maintained by Microsoft. Atom is a coding editor that was developed by Github.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|